Pests Common in Bethany

Bethany’s combination of established trees, aging housing stock, and lake proximity creates persistent pest problems across the city. The NW 39th Expressway corridor draws commercial pest activity including German cockroaches and rodents in restaurants and retail spaces. Residential streets near Southern Nazarene University feature some of the oldest homes in the area, with crawlspace foundations that invite Oriental cockroaches, moisture pests, and termites traveling through Oklahoma’s clay soils. Lake Overholser sits right on Bethany’s eastern border, and the wildlife corridor it creates pushes raccoons deep into residential neighborhoods. Raccoons access attics through deteriorating soffits and gable vents, leaving contaminated insulation and creating electrical hazards from chewing. House mice are the primary rodent invader in Bethany’s older homes, entering through foundation gaps, pipe penetrations, and cracked mortar joints. Fall invasion peaks from September through December as temperatures drop. Mosquitoes breed in standing water along the Lake Overholser drainage area and affect Bethany neighborhoods throughout the warm season. Fire ants are aggressive in residential yards across the city, and brown recluse spiders thrive in the undisturbed storage areas and crawlspaces of older homes.

Bethany Pest Season Calendar

January and February: Winter is the quietest season, but rodents are actively denning inside homes and crawlspaces. Indoor cockroach populations remain active in heated structures. Wildlife including raccoons and opossums may already be denning in attics and crawlspaces, particularly in homes near Lake Overholser.

March and April: Termite swarm season begins as soil temperatures warm. Subterranean termite swarmers emerge inside Bethany’s crawlspace homes and older construction near SNU. Fire ant mounds reappear across lawns. Rodent mobility increases as spring activity picks up. Mole activity increases in shaded yards.

May and June: Mosquito season begins along the Lake Overholser drainage corridor. Carpenter ants become highly active near mature trees. Wasp and yellowjacket colonies are building rapidly. Bat maternity season begins May 1; no exclusion permitted until August 15. Wildlife activity peaks with raccoons raising young in attic spaces.

July and August: Peak mosquito pressure across Bethany, especially in eastern neighborhoods near Lake Overholser. Fire ants are aggressive. Spiders and scorpions are at peak indoor entry. Flea and tick pressure peaks on pets and in yards. Gopher activity continues in open lawn areas.

September and October: Fall armyworm outbreaks can devastate Bethany lawns within days. Rodent fall invasion begins as mice seek indoor shelter through foundation gaps and pipe penetrations. Bagworms and webworms are visible on ornamental trees. Second termite swarm window in early fall. Raccoons begin seeking winter denning sites in attics.

November and December: Rodent intrusion peaks as cold weather drives house mice indoors through every available gap. Wildlife settles into winter dens. Indoor pest pressure focuses on spiders, cockroaches, and occasional scorpions. This is the most critical window for sealing entry points before winter denning is established.

Why does Lake Overholser affect pest pressure in Bethany?

Lake Overholser sits on Bethany’s eastern border and creates a wildlife corridor that pushes raccoons, opossums, skunks, and other animals directly into residential neighborhoods. The lake and its drainage areas also provide ideal mosquito breeding habitat, extending mosquito season and increasing population density in nearby neighborhoods. Homeowners in eastern Bethany should expect heavier wildlife and mosquito pressure than the rest of the city, and proactive exclusion and mosquito treatment make a significant difference.

Are older homes in Bethany more at risk for termites?

Yes. Bethany has a high concentration of homes built in the mid-1900s with crawlspace foundations, and many of these structures have earth-to-wood contact, settling cracks, and moisture conditions that subterranean termites exploit. Homes near the SNU campus and along Peniel Road are particularly vulnerable. Annual termite inspections are strongly recommended for any Bethany home with a crawlspace foundation, and liquid barrier treatments provide lasting protection.

When is the best time to rodent-proof a Bethany home?

The ideal time to seal entry points is late summer, before the fall rodent invasion begins in September. House mice are the primary rodent invader in Bethany, and they enter through gaps as small as a quarter inch in foundations, pipe penetrations, and deteriorating soffits. Waiting until mice are already inside means you need both elimination and exclusion. Proactive sealing in August or September prevents the problem before it starts.

Do you handle raccoon problems near Lake Overholser?

Yes. Raccoon pressure from the Lake Overholser corridor is one of the most common wildlife calls we receive in Bethany. Raccoons access attics through deteriorating soffits, gable vents, and roof returns. Once inside, they establish latrines contaminated with Baylisascaris roundworm and chew electrical wiring, creating fire hazards. We trap and remove raccoons, seal entry points, and provide attic remediation to address contamination. Professional cleanup of raccoon latrines is mandatory due to the health risks involved.
